    Notes: Summary The authors describe a newly designed nerve monitor which is useful for numerous microneurosurgical procedures. Standard bipolar forceps are used to apply constant current stimulation. Muscle contraction evoked by the stimulation is detected by a small discshaped pressure sensor taped to the overlying skin. The responses are monitored both quantitatively on a liquid crystal display and qualitatively through an on-off auditory signal. Surgery can proceed without interruption. This apparatus can safely and reliably monitor the facial nerve, nerves involved in eye movements, lower cranial nerves and spinal nerves. This portable system weighs only 1.8 kg and can easily be used by a neurosurgeon.

    Notes: Summary Since surgeons sometimes encounter difficulty in keeping self-retaining soft tissue retractors in the proper position for anterior cervical spinal surgery, we have developed a new, simple soft tissue retractor system, which is fixed to the side rails of the operating table via retractor stands. All three joints of the retractor can be tightened simultaneously with a single handle. Each of two retractor blades can keep its position independent of the other thereby maintaining a well-exposed operative field for a long period of time. Fine adjustments of the blade position, after fixation of the retractors, is possible by sliding the head of the blade assembly along the axis of a ratchet mechanism. We have used these retractors in 43 surgical exposures, including 35 for anterior cervical fusion, 2 for posterior thoraco-lumbar decompression, and 6 for carotid endarterectomy. There have been no complications related to tissue damage.
